☐ Museum label run — Aldgrave Gallery of Tidecraft. Collect the flat crate of printed labels for the new Saltworks wing from the Pellen print shop. Labels are fragile; keep crate horizontal. Deliver to the gallery loading dock before 09:30 install start. Give the courier the hand-over instruction noted below.

handover note for yagef-bagep: the drudor pelius courier leaves the kasdor zorvan norir ledger at gate 8016 under passcode 755406

## Service Accounts — FanPipe Backpressure

FanPipe throttles notification fan-out when downstream queues back up. Support can inspect throttle state via the internal backpressure API. Access requires the `fanpipe-support` service account; do not use personal credentials. The account is read-only: it can view queue depth, shed rates, and per-tenant limits, but cannot change them. Escalate limit changes to the platform team. Requests go through the standard gateway with the key header. Current service-account key:

gateway credential: kto3_qfe

## Onboarding: Reminder Job (Larkwell Clinics)

Quick context for your review: the reminder job runs nightly, pulls tomorrow's appointments from the Larkwell scheduler, and queues SMS sends. No patient data leaves the worker subnet. Secrets live in the vault, rotated quarterly. For sandbox testing only, the job authenticates to the internal scheduler API with the key below.

API key for tagug-tajef: vxb4-R1fo